Textile Reinforced Concrete(TRC)is a new type of fiber-reinforced composite with fine concrete as the matrix.TRC has significantly advantages in structural reinforcement as follow characters: high strength,high toughness and good compatibility with building structure.This paper focuses on to study the effect of masonry structure reinforced with TRC,and the axial pressure text of masonry columns reinforced with TRC and the joint section shear text of masonry structure reinforced with TRC were carried out.The main research contents are as follows:(1)The text of axial compression on 9 damaged clay brick columns reinforced with TRC was carried out.The results show that,TRC can effectively restrain the columns and perform well in increasing bearing capacity and improving the failure mode and the capacity of deformation;the reinforcement effect of TRC is improved with the increasing of the layers of textile within a certain range;textile covered with sands can improve the cracking load;the lap length of the textile has little influence on reinforcement effect of TRC;the cracking load is increased significantly when chopped PVA fibers used to modify TRC matrix,and the ultimate load is also improved;the pre-damaged situation can affect columns' cracking load,pre-damaged more serious cracking load increase the smaller.(2)The test of masonry shear strength along mortar joints on 6 groups of 18 brick masonry specimens reinforced with TRC was carried out.The results show that,TRC can effectively improve the shear strength and ductility of brick masonry;the reinforcing effect of the textile braid is better than that of the horizontal arrangement;the increasing of the layers of textile can improve the reinforcement effect of TRC within a certain range;textile covered with sands can improve the ductility of brick masonry,but has little effect on the improvement of shear strength;adding chopped PVA fibers to modify matrix can improve the shear strength and delay the development of cracks of brick masonry.(3)According to the calculation model of the restrained concrete column,the bearing capacity calculation formula of damaged clay brick column reinforced with TRC is given;the shear strength formula of TRC strengthen brick masonry is given based on the principle of fixed pulley.The result of the calculation has good agreement with that of experiments.
